PRE-EVALUATION

To fetch a better understanding of the objectives of STEP, it coordinated with TESDA and JITCO regarding its role in the Technology Transfer Project. It will only facilitate the better selection and matching of skills and training requirements. STEP conducts preliminary selection and evaluation of trainee candidates. A thorough investigation of individual backgound, test of skills and the quality of ones character are very important points in the nomination of candidates for selection by Accepting Companies.

The candidates are being requested to undergo preliminary Japanese language training course prior to interview by Japanese Accepting Companies. In this way, companies will not find it hard to communicate with the applicants. An overview of the Japanese culture and values of work is being given to each trainee. The importance and real meaning of the training program is presented. Various tests, examinations, and evaluations are being applied in order to get onlyknowledgeable and dedicated trainees.
